Territory Manager - MedTech (Philadelphia, PA)
Philadelphia, PA
unspecified Salary not disclosedTerritory Manager - MedTech (Philadelphia, PA) Philadelphia, PA KEY D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ILTIES - Develops and drives strategies, including resource development and deployment to meet patient implant and revenue goals. - Ensures execution of strategies to deliver on metrics within Territory. - Demonstrates expert proficiency with regard to Salesforce, Salesforce dashboards, forecasting, and CVRx commercial business applications, with the ability and desire to teach others. - Maintains a thorough understanding of complex physiological and technical principles pertaining to CVRx technologies and therapies. - Supports implants and follow-up procedures and visits. Provides troubleshooting and other technical assistance to healthcare providers and CVRx employees. - Receives technical inquiries and researches solutions to questions or problems. - Represents CVRx devices in front of leading cardiologists, hypertension specialists, and cardiac/vascular surgeons to ensure their understanding of the clinical therapy. - Provides on-call clinical support as needed, troubleshooting, including in-service education and training physicians in one-on-one sessions, and delivery of in-service education programs for hospital personnel and staff on technical matters relating to CVRx devices or studies. - Provides R&D support through customer feedback on product enhancements or new product development ideas. - Adheres to sales management processes and reporting systems usage to ensure disciplined implementation of commercial strategy for assigned area. Maintains an accurate record of devices and programmers at all times in Salesforce. - Other duties as assigned. REQUIRED EDUCATIONAL TRAINING AND EXPERIENCE - BS or equivalent degree in health sciences, engineering, or business, or a combination of experience and education may be considered

The Role The Vice President, Legal is a direct report of the CEO and member of the Executive Leadership Team responsible for providing strategic, business‑forward legal guidance in a fast‑growing, publicly traded medical device company. This role leads day‑to‑day legal operations, oversees corporate compliance, manages contract strategy and execution, and partners closely with outside counsel on complex matters including securities, governance, and corporate transactions. This is a high‑impact, hands‑on leadership role for an attorney who thrives in dynamic environments and is energized by building and improving legal infrastructure. The VP, Legal will serve as the company's most senior in‑house legal authority, empowered to make decisions, drive outcomes, and shape a modern, business‑aligned legal function during a pivotal stage of growth. A day in the life: This is not an Accounting role. The Director of Payer Relations is in charge of developing, strategizing, and implementing all necessary actions in order to obtain payer access, reimbursement, and coverage, for CVRx products, to the markets determined by the senior management. This position is expected to support strategic payer outreach, work on Medicare initiatives involving inpatient, outpatient, ambulatory surgery center and physician payment projects, as well as achieving policies with commercial and government insurance payers. In this role, you are expected to support hospital and physician customer meetings on reimbursement topics, claims tracking program to resolve claims issues, create payer policies, marketing market access value propositions, sales training materials and programs, and other reimbursement projects.
